One of the Olympos XII, it is a Digimon "God of Smithery". Most well-known weapons are the work of Vulcanusmon, and the famous "Berenjena" cherished by Beelzebumon is also an article of Vulcanusmon's. It has an artisan's pride and a stubborn personality. It sees through the competence of its clients, and when it feels that they can not master or will not treasure the weapon, it will deny the request. When building, it performs with a standard of work corresponding to the other party. As such, the "Berenjena" that it put all of its effort into after being charmed by Beelzebumon's power is considered to be an excellent article, even by Vulcanusmon. Although it's a Digimon that freely manipulates its eight arms and works in silence, it exhibits an artisan's style even in battle. It radiates its "Bomber Art", flames to use for welding, and manufactures then and there an appropriate weapon to fit the situation (Pinpoint Weapon Works). Furthermore, during its "Appropriate Works", in which it equips its weapons, manufactured one after another with its "Pinpoint Weapon Works", to each of its arms, all of Vulcanusmon's power is fully unleashed. However, Vulcanusmon's own fighting ability is not very great, so it prefers working behind the scenes to fighting in person.

Attack Techniques[edit]

Name Kanji/Kana Romanization Description
Bomber Art [1] ボンバーアート Bonbā Āto Radiates flames to use for welding.[1]
Pinpoint Weapon Works [1] ピンポイントウェポンワークス Pinpointo Wepon Wākusu Uses its Bomber Art and manufactures then and there an appropriate weapon to fit the situation.[1]
Appropriate Works [1] アプロプリエートワークス Apuropuriēto Wākusu Manufactures weapons by performing Pinpoint Weapon Works one after another, then equips them to each of its arms in order to fully unleash all of its power.[1]

Digimon Story: Time Stranger[edit]

Voice Actor: Japanese Miyazaki Hiromu

Vulcanusmon is the leader of the Factorial Area and an Apostle of Iliad. When first encountered, he attacks the party with the Divine Arms Ω.

Vulcanusmon in Digimon Story Time Stranger.

Vulcanusmon is a Data-type, Ultimate-level Digimon of the Tolerance personality. It evolves from Dagomon or Anomalocarimon if their Defense is 1700 or higher and Spirit is 1820 or higher, and if the player's Agent Rank is 7 or higher. The stat requirements can be cut by up to 4.71 through certain Agent Skills. Its signature moves are Appropriate Works (25 Steel physical damage to one foe; hits 4 times; increased damage against foes with the Weapon gene) and Pinpoint Weapon Works (80 Null physical damage to one foe; increased damage if target has the Mineral gene and/or if their type is anything but No Data). It is weak to Earth and Null, resists Fire and blocks Steel.
